#[derive(Serialize, Deserialize, Debug, Clone, Eq)]
pub struct ProblemId(String);

impl ProblemId {
    pub fn normalize(&self) -> String {
        self.0.to_uppercase()
    }
}

impl PartialEq<ProblemId> for ProblemId {
    fn eq(&self, other: &ProblemId) -> bool {
        self.normalize() == other.normalize()
    }
}

impl PartialOrd for ProblemId {
    fn partial_cmp(&self, other: &ProblemId) -> Option<Ordering> {
        Some(self.normalize().cmp(&other.normalize()))
    }
}

impl Ord for ProblemId {
    fn cmp(&self, other: &Self) -> Ordering {
        self.normalize().cmp(&other.normalize())
    }
}

impl Hash for ProblemId {
    fn hash<H: Hasher>(&self, state: &mut H) {
        self.normalize().hash(state);
    }
}

impl<T: Into<String>> From<T> for ProblemId {
    fn from(id: T) -> Self {
        Self(id.into())
    }
}

impl FromStr for ProblemId {
    type Err = Infallible;

    fn from_str(s: &str) -> std::result::Result<Self, Self::Err> {
        Ok(Self::from(s))
    }
}

impl fmt::Display for ProblemId {
    fn fmt(&self, f: &mut fmt::Formatter) -> fmt::Result {
        f.write_str(&self.0)
    }
}

pub mod string {
    use std::fmt::Display;
    use std::str::FromStr;

    use serde::{de, Deserialize, Deserializer, Serializer};

    pub fn serialize<T, S>(value: &T, serializer: S) -> Result<S::Ok, S::Error>
    where
        T: Display,
        S: Serializer,
    {
        serializer.collect_str(value)
    }

    pub fn deserialize<'de, T, D>(deserializer: D) -> Result<T, D::Error>
    where
        T: FromStr,
        T::Err: Display,
        D: Deserializer<'de>,
    {
        String::deserialize(deserializer)?
            .parse()
            .map_err(de::Error::custom)
    }
}
